A deadline set by Palestinian militant groups holding an Israeli soldier captive has passed without any change in the uneasy standoff. Israeli Cpl. Gilad Shalit was kidnapped on June 25 in southern Israel by three militant groups that demanded Israel start releasing Palestinian prisoners by 6 a.m. Tuesday (11 p.m. ET Monday) or suffer the consequences. The statement — from the military wing of Hamas, the Popular Resistance Committees and the Army of Islam — never said what the consequences would be if Jerusalem did not act. Full Story
